Stephen Wolfram is a renowned computer scientist, physicist, and entrepreneur, best known for his work in the fields of computation and complex systems. He is the founder and CEO of Wolfram Research, where he developed the Wolfram Language and the computational software Mathematica. His groundbreaking book, "A New Kind of Science," challenges traditional scientific paradigms and explores the implications of computational systems in understanding natural phenomena. Wolfram's innovative ideas have significantly influenced various fields, including mathematics, physics, and computer science, by introducing a new approach to problem-solving and exploration through computation.

Wolfram's early life was marked by a deep curiosity about science and mathematics, which led him to pursue a PhD in theoretical physics at the California Institute of Technology.
